Mystic — Annie Helena Silva left this world on Monday, Oct. 23, 2017, at Lawrence + Memorial Hospital, with her family at her side.

She was born in Mystic, on Sept. 5, 1921, to Thomas and Lucinda (Whitman) Whittle, the oldest of three daughters. She grew up in Mystic, attended local schools and graduated from Fitch High School in 1939 and the Joseph Lawrence School of Nursing in 1942.

She married Theo A. Silva on May 2, 1942. They celebrated their 58th anniversar­y shortly before his passing in June of 2000. At the time of her passing, she was the oldest living member of the Thomas and Frederick Whittle family of Willow Spring Farm and the John Whittle family formerly of Burnett’s Corner. She grew up working in all areas of the business from planting, harvesting and selling, starting out on a concrete slab in front of her grandparen­ts’, and later parents’ farm house on Noank Ledyard Road.

She worked in her profession until the age of 70. She spent 25 years at Lawrence + Memorial Hospital and then at the pediatric offices of Dr. Sayre, Dolan, Robinson, Andrews and Stein in both New London and Mystic.

Besides her husband and parents, she was predecease­d by her two younger sisters and their husbands, Katherine Whittle Thompson (Harold) and Irene Whittle Umrysz (John); and a granddaugh­ter, Margaret (Banks) Nye.

She is survived by her four children, all of Mystic. Her daughter, Constance Banks-Williams; sons, Thomas (Donna), Rick (Carol) and Vin; 13 grandchild­ren, 29 great-grandchild­ren and nine great-great-grandchild­ren. She is also survived by many nieces, nephews and cousins.

Special thanks to her youngest son, Vin, with whom she shared a birthday. She would not have been able to remain in her home these last few years without him.
